Banda Black Rio is a Brazilian musical group from Rio de Janeiro that was formed in 1976. They were one of the first to undertake the fusion of Essential Brazilian Music with International Black Music. The songs are based on funk but also including samba, jazz and Brazilian rhythms. Compared to other soul-funk groups, such as Kool & the Gang and Earth, Wind and Fire, Banda Black Rio developed a particular style of instrumental soul music fusing together elements from a number of genres. With saxophonist Oberdan Magalhaes, trumpet player Barrosinho, Cristovao Bastos on keyboards, Claudio Stevenson on guitars, Jamil Joanes on bass and Lucio Silva on trombone. Arrangements are from Cristovao Bastos and Claudio Stevenson. The album "Saci Pererê" was originally released in 1980.
